Clean up BUILDCONFIG.gn
Starting a new project requires copying Pigweed's BUILDCONFIG.gn as the
foundation for a project's own BUILDCONFIG. This change adds
documentation and some minor changes to the structure of the BUILDCONFIG
to simplify it.

+# This BUILDCONFIG file tells GN how to build upstream Pigweed. When starting a
+# new project, you'll need to copy this file to your project and then modify it
+# to fit your needs. Due to the way Pigweed handles file imports, you won't be
+# able to simply import this file in your own BUILDCONFIG.gn.
+#
+# Keep in mind when importing .gni files that `gn format` will try to
+# alphabetically sort imports unless they're separated by comments. For this
+# file, import order matters (modules.gni MUST be imported first).

+# Import variables that provide paths to modules. Pigweed's GN build requires
+# that this file is imported, and it MUST be imported before any other Pigweed
+# .gni files (as they depend on the dir_[module] variables).
+import("$dir_pigweed/modules.gni")
+
+# Import default GN configurations. This file provides default configurations
+# for upstream Pigweed development, and projects are free to provide their own
+# variation of this file. (depends on modules.gni)
+import("$dir_pigweed/gn_defaults.gni")
+
+# Import target configuration. This is what "completes" a Pigweed configuration.
+# This file should set a default toolchain, configure pw_executable, select
+# backends to build against, and provide target-specific build arguments.
